Had an amazing experience at this restaurant with my fiancee on our trip to Gaspésie. For appetizers, we had the scallop crudo and beef tartare. Even though the portion of the scallop was small, it was sweet, tender and the sauce was delicious. The beef tartare was succulent. For mains, we had fish and chips + seafood pasta. Although I didn't enjoy the tartare sauce, the fish was crispy and tasty on its own. The seafood pasta was excellent, creamy and full of seafood flavour. Finally, for dessert, we took the panna cotta and crème brulée, which were a perfect ending for our meal. Not to mention the kindness of all the servers we had. Highly recommended restaurant if you ever go to Percé!

Eh là là. Ma première déception de restaurants en sept jours en Gaspésie. Par où commencer? On dirait un resto qui veut se donner un coté moderne et chic, mais qui a manqué sa shot. OU...simplement une belle grosse trappe à touristes. Le nom et le beau logo Buvette Thérèse ont attiré mon attention. Dès que j'ai passé la porte, j'ai eu un doute de mon choix, mais voyons voir car de toute façon, j'avais réservé. Je suis bien accueillie. La musique chillout donne une allure branchée. On me donne le menu et la carte des vins. Presque tout manque de finesse. Le menu est une page recto toute nue. La carte des vins est assez limitée. Il y a quelques bières locales (Pit Caribou, À l'abri de la tempête et Le naufrageur). Les cocktails gagneraient en valeur si les produits locaux (s'il y a) étaient écrits. Rien ne dit non plus si ce restaurant cuisine des poissons et fruits de mer de la Gaspésie. Une belle mention pour l'assiette utilisée qui garde le repas bien chaud. Je réalise en essayant de trouver un repas que ́e chef n'est sûrement pas fan des légumes et est plutôt porté sur les protéines. J'opte donc pour le fish & chips à 36$. Imaginez vous donc que pour ce prix, ce sont des frites congelées de style Cavendish !!! Les trois filets sont ok, mais sans plus. Je vous ferai remarquer qu'ils ont ́la même forme que des filets de poissons congelés (je n'ose même pas y penser!!!). Une chose est certaine, ce plat ne vaut pas 36$! Aucun petit pain ou autre délicatesse pour nous faire patienter au repas. Je n'ai pas voulu voir la carte des desserts. Je voulais sacrer mon camp. Capacité de 50-60 personnes. Arrivée à 17h: 3 clients (y compris moi-même). Départ à 18h: 3 clients (y compris moi-même). Je suis allé voir le restaurant de l'autre côté de la rue qui est beaucoup plus grand à 18h. C'était full!
